1. Conduct Neurology-Focused Keyword Research

Start by identifying the specific terms that potential patients use when they look for neurology care in your region. Consider:

  • Core Services & Conditions: “Migraine treatment,” “Parkinson’s disease specialist,” “EEG testing,” “Multiple sclerosis clinic,” or “nerve conduction studies.”
  • Location Modifiers: Pair these services or conditions with geographic references—“migraine specialist in [City/Neighborhood],” “pediatric neurology near me,” etc.
  • Long-Tail Searches: More specific queries such as “best epilepsy doctor for children in [Region],” “non-surgical migraine relief [City],” or “how to manage MS locally.”

Tools like Google Keyword Planner or SEMrush can reveal search volumes and competition levels, guiding which keywords to prioritize. Additionally, direct feedback from existing patients—what words they use, how they describe conditions—can refine your list.

2. Optimize Your Google Business Profile

Your Google Business Profile (GBP) is a cornerstone of local SEO. When set up properly, it boosts your chances of appearing in Google’s “local pack” for neurology-related searches. Focus on:

  • Accurate Practice Details: Provide your correct address, phone number, and consistent name across all references. Include your office hours, website link, and appointment booking information (if relevant).
  • Robust Category & Services: Choose “Neurologist” or other relevant healthcare categories. Break down services (e.g., “Nerve conduction tests,” “Stroke evaluation”) in the services section if available.
  • Engaging Description: Write a concise overview of your practice—highlighting specialties, advanced equipment, or unique patient-care philosophies. A friendly yet professional tone works best.
  • Visual Elements: Upload high-quality photos of your clinic’s exterior, reception area, or staff. This visual transparency offers patients a glimpse of your environment, easing pre-visit anxieties.
  • Google Posts & Updates: Periodically share updates about new services, open houses, or relevant health tips. Google Posts can keep your listing current and appealing.

Completeness and ongoing management of your GBP significantly impact how well you rank for local searches. Always ensure data is updated—like if you add a new location or adjust clinic hours for holidays.

3. Build a Location-Friendly Site Structure

For multi-location neurology practices or those wishing to emphasize multiple service areas, your website’s structure should accommodate local SEO. Tips include:

  • Dedicated Location Pages: Each office or coverage region gets its own page, listing address, contact info, doctor bios, and local highlights (like nearby landmarks or directions). This aids location-based indexing.
  • Service-Specific Subpages: If you handle different neurological specialties, create separate pages for them, each incorporating local references. For example, “Pediatric Neurology in [City]” or “EMG Testing near [Neighborhood].”
  • Mobile-Friendly Design: Many patients search on mobile devices—particularly for urgent or specialized health needs. Streamline your site’s mobile navigation, especially for location or appointment info.
  • Structured Data Markup: Add healthcare-related schema to highlight your practice details. This can aid search engines in displaying relevant snippets in local results.

When content is well-organized into relevant pages, search engines better understand your geographic and service coverage, increasing the likelihood of top placement for local neurology queries.

5. Earn & Manage Local Reviews

Patient reviews significantly influence how new clients perceive your practice. A strong set of positive, genuine testimonials can boost local rankings and quell anxiety about neurology appointments:

  • Automated Feedback Requests: After visits, email or text patients a polite request for feedback on Google or healthcare review platforms (Healthgrades, Yelp, Vitals). Make it easy with direct links.
  • Highlight Patient Experiences: Feature star ratings or short quotes on your website’s location pages. Emphasize patients who overcame significant conditions thanks to your care.
  • Prompt Responses: Publicly thank positive reviewers. Address negative feedback professionally, offering to discuss or resolve offline. This shows you value patient satisfaction.
  • Showcase Affiliations: Accreditations, board certifications, or professional memberships lend credibility. Pair them with positive feedback to underscore your practice’s high standards.

A well-managed review strategy fosters a trustworthy online reputation. Potential patients, especially those with neurology concerns, see proof that your clinic delivers skilled, compassionate care.

7. Use Schema Markup & Technical Best Practices

Proper site coding can make your neurology practice more appealing to search engines, especially for local queries:

  • Medical Clinic Schema: If you’re recognized as a medical entity, implementing schema helps Google display relevant details like address, phone, and opening hours in SERPs.
  • Physician & Healthcare Professional Markup: Highlight each neurologist’s specialization with “Physician” or “HealthcareProfessional” markup to signal deeper details about your staff to search engines.
  • Site Speed & Mobile Optimization: Compress images of your staff or clinic. Remove redundant plugins. Guarantee smooth, responsive design to keep bounce rates low on mobile devices.
  • Security Measures (HTTPS): Handling sensitive medical queries means site security is paramount. HTTPS indicates trust, essential for both user confidence and Google’s ranking factors.

Though often behind-the-scenes, technical enhancements matter. They increase the likelihood of your practice appearing in local search packs, knowledge panels, and featured snippets relevant to neurological care.

9. Track & Refine Metrics

To ensure your local SEO and Google Maps strategies keep driving results, monitor key metrics and adjust as needed:

  • Search Rankings & Visibility: Check your positions for top neurology keywords in each targeted region. Tools like Moz or SEMrush help track fluctuations.
  • Google Business Profile Insights: Review how many times your listing is viewed, the volume of direction requests, phone calls initiated, or website clicks from GBP. Spikes or dips often reflect changes in strategy effectiveness.
  • Organic Traffic & Conversions: Analyze how many site visitors actually schedule appointments or fill out contact forms. High impressions but low conversions might signal a user experience or content mismatch.
  • Review Ratings & Counts: See if your average rating improves and if new reviews roll in consistently. Encourage more feedback if volume stagnates.

Data-driven insights let you fine-tune your approach—maybe updating content for underperforming location pages or intensifying efforts on certain service lines if patient interest surges. Over time, small optimizations collectively strengthen your brand’s local presence.
